# WinOS Config
A declarative configuration system for Windows 11, inspired by NixOS. The goal is to describe the complete state of a Windows machine in version-controlled configuration files.
## Project Goals
- **Declarative**: Define _what_ the system should look like, not _how_ to get there
- **Reproducible**: Apply the same config to multiple machines with identical results
- **Version controlled**: Track all configuration changes in git
- **Modular**: Compose configurations for different hosts (gaming-pc, work-laptop, htpc)

## Technology Options Under Consideration
### 1. DSC v3 (Microsoft Desired State Configuration)
**Pros:**
- Actively maintained (v3.1.2 released Nov 2025, v3.2.0-preview.8 in progress)
- Complete rewrite in Rust - no PowerShell dependency
- Cross-platform (Windows, macOS, Linux)
- JSON/YAML configuration files
- JSON Schema available for validation/type generation
- Resources can be written in any language
- Adapters for legacy PowerShell DSC resources
- WinGet integration via `microsoft/winget-dsc`
**Cons:**
- No official TypeScript/Python/Go SDKs or language bindings
- Configuration is YAML/JSON (not a real programming language)
- **Does NOT auto-uninstall packages when removed from config**
- Limited built-in resources - most functionality requires adapters
- No native WSL configuration resource
- No Start Menu/taskbar pin configuration

### 2. Ansible
**Pros:**
- Mature ecosystem with large community
- YAML-based with inventory system for multi-host
- Idempotent task execution
- Good Windows support via WinRM
**Cons:**
- Requires control node (Linux/WSL) to run FROM
- YAML configuration (not a real language)
- **Does NOT auto-uninstall packages when removed from config** - requires explicit `state: absent`
- Windows modules less mature than Linux
### 3. PowerShell DSC v2 (Legacy)
**Pros:**
- Full PowerShell language features
- Native Windows integration
- Can compose configurations programmatically
**Cons:**
- Being superseded by DSC v3
- MOF-based, more complex
- **Does NOT auto-uninstall when removed from config**
### 4. Custom TypeScript Tooling
**Pros:**
- Full language features (types, functions, loops, conditionals)
- Can generate DSC v3 YAML from TypeScript
- Type safety via JSON Schema → TypeScript generation
- Familiar tooling (Bun, npm ecosystem)
**Cons:**
- Must build/maintain the tooling ourselves
- Thin wrapper around DSC v3 CLI
### 5. WinGet Configuration (standalone)
**Pros:**
- Native Windows, simple YAML
- Built on DSC v3 under the hood
- `winget configure` command
**Cons:**
- Single file per configuration (limited modularity)
- **Does NOT auto-uninstall when removed from config**

## The Uninstall Problem
### NixOS Behavior (What We Want)
In NixOS, removing a package from `configuration.nix` and running `nixos-rebuild switch` will:
1. Build a new system profile without that package
2. Switch to the new profile
3. The package is no longer available
### Windows Reality (What We Get)
**No Windows configuration tool provides true "remove on deletion" behavior.**
| Tool | Behavior When Package Removed From Config |
|------|-------------------------------------------|
| DSC v3 | Stops managing it - package remains installed |
| Ansible | Nothing happens - requires explicit `state: absent` |
| WinGet Config | Nothing happens - package remains installed |
| Chocolatey DSC | Nothing happens - package remains installed |
### Workarounds
1. **Explicit "absent" lists**: Maintain a separate list of packages that should NOT be present
```yaml
packages_present:
- Google.Chrome
- Git.Git
packages_absent:
- Microsoft.Edge # Explicitly remove
```
2. **State diffing**: Build tooling that compares current state vs desired state and generates removal tasks
3. **Full reset approach**: Periodically wipe and reapply (not practical for daily use)

## What Can Be Configured
### Fully Supported
| Category | Method | Notes |
|----------|--------|-------|
| **Package Installation** | WinGet DSC | Searches winget-pkgs repository |
| **Registry Settings** | `Microsoft.Windows/Registry` | Theme, Explorer options, etc. |
| **Environment Variables** | PSDscResources adapter | System and user variables |
| **Windows Services** | PSDscResources adapter | Start/stop, startup type |
| **Windows Features** | PSDscResources adapter | Enable/disable optional features |
### Partially Supported
| Category | Method | Limitations |
|----------|--------|-------------|
| **WSL Enable** | WindowsOptionalFeature | Works via adapter |
| **WSL Distro Install** | WinGet | Install only, no config |
| **File Creation** | Script resource | Not declarative, imperative script |
### Not Supported (Manual/Script Required)
| Category | Why |
|----------|-----|
| **`.wslconfig` file** | No file content resource in DSC v3 |
| **Start Menu Layout** | Complex binary format, export/import only |
| **Taskbar Pinned Apps** | Complex, no resource exists |
| **Default Browser** | Requires user interaction |
| **File Associations** | Registry-based but complex |
| **Microsoft Account Sync** | Cloud-based, not local config |

## Registry Paths for Common Settings
### Theme & Appearance
```
# Dark mode (apps)
HKCU\SOFTWARE\Microsoft\Windows\CurrentVersion\Themes\Personalize
AppsUseLightTheme = 0 (dark) | 1 (light)
# Dark mode (system)
HKCU\SOFTWARE\Microsoft\Windows\CurrentVersion\Themes\Personalize
SystemUsesLightTheme = 0 (dark) | 1 (light)
# Taskbar alignment (Windows 11)
HKCU\Software\Microsoft\Windows\CurrentVersion\Explorer\Advanced
TaskbarAl = 0 (left) | 1 (center)
# Accent color on title bars
HKCU\SOFTWARE\Microsoft\Windows\DWM
ColorPrevalence = 0 (off) | 1 (on)
```
### Explorer Settings
```
# Show file extensions
HKCU\Software\Microsoft\Windows\CurrentVersion\Explorer\Advanced
HideFileExt = 0 (show) | 1 (hide)
# Show hidden files
HKCU\Software\Microsoft\Windows\CurrentVersion\Explorer\Advanced
Hidden = 1 (show) | 2 (hide)
# Show full path in title bar
HKCU\Software\Microsoft\Windows\CurrentVersion\Explorer\CabinetState
FullPath = 1 (show) | 0 (hide)
```
### Privacy & Telemetry
```
# Disable Cortana
HKLM\SOFTWARE\Policies\Microsoft\Windows\Windows Search
AllowCortana = 0 (disabled) | 1 (enabled)
# Telemetry level (requires admin)
HKLM\SOFTWARE\Policies\Microsoft\Windows\DataCollection
AllowTelemetry = 0 (security) | 1 (basic) | 2 (enhanced) | 3 (full)
```

## DSC v3 JSON Schema (For TypeScript Generation)
DSC v3 publishes JSON schemas that can be used to generate TypeScript types:
```bash
# Download bundled schema
curl -o schemas/dsc-config.schema.json \
https://raw.githubusercontent.com/PowerShell/DSC/main/schemas/2024/04/bundled/config/document.json
# Generate TypeScript types
bunx json-schema-to-typescript schemas/dsc-config.schema.json > src/types/dsc-config.d.ts
```
